How much does it cost to rent a home in Toluca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Toluca Lake 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,817 | $2,295 | $10,000+ |
| Toluca Lake 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,435 | $3,195 | $10,000+ |
| Toluca Lake 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$12,843 | $3,693 | $10,000+ |
| Toluca Lake 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$17,484 | $5,750 | $10,000+ |
| Toluca Lake 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$33,487 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Toluca Lake
What type of rentals are currently available in Toluca Lake?
There are currently 2725 Apartments for Rent in Toluca Lake,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,011 to $7,257. There are also 338 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Toluca Lake ranging from $1,395 to $60,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Toluca Lake?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Toluca Lake ranges from $1,395 to $60,000 with an average monthly rent of $7,600.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Toluca Lake?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Toluca Lake range from $2,488 to $7,257,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$3,195 to $30,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,693 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,771.
